Full description
On this full-day excursion you’ll take in some of the most breathtaking features of the Nahuel Huapi National Park. Visit lakes, beaches, mountains, and waterfalls, and admire the highest mountain in the Patagonia. Mount Tronador, 3,478 meters high, forms a natural border between Chile and Argentina. From the viewpoint at its base you can see the incredible glacier that feeds the Manso River. See the Ventisquero Negro (Black Glacier) that consists of huge brownish-gray blocks formed by avalanches of ice and mud. Visit La Garganta del Diablo (The Devil’s Throat), a waterfall created by melted glacial ice, surrounded by high rock walls, and see the Saltillo de las Nalcas, a hidden waterfall in the middle of the forest. This mountain’s name, Tronador, comes from the thunderous sounds produced by the massive falling blocks of ice.

You're not going to get a lot of communication in advance so here's how this trip works. We were on a larger bus, very comfortable. They start to pick up at 9am but will go to each hotel, so expect that you could have 10-12 stops. The bus also will stop by the road so be on the lookout outside of your hotel. They don't message you in advance. The tour is quite good, a lot of history, they make about 7 stops in the park. Two of them have restroom areas. The last wil stop will be for two hours and there's a little restaurant there. The Huapi National park is beautiful and this is a great way to see it. Waterfalls, glaciers, mountains. Not a lot of hiking, mostly get out and see an area but the beauty is worth it. This will be a 9 hour round trip so plan for that.

Overall, a very good tour. The tour involves a quite lengthy drive on rough land inside the national park which was indeed tiring but amusing. This is the only way to drive inside the park anyway. Our guide Isis was great: very friendly, very knowledgeable and super helpful. The tour was also good in terms of organization, stops for toilet and brief stops for photos at scenic spots. Something noteworthy (at least to me) is the absence of trash bins in almost all locations. Visitors must return with their residuals due to the limited garbage collection service imposed by the nature of the place. Recommended.
